Italian Stone Names

Currently, there are many companies around the world that use generic names to identify different types of stone. This has created a problem for the stone maintenance industry. The original names were in Italian. Usually the name consists of two parts. The first part describes the color and the second part describes the name from where the stone was quarried.
ITALIAN NAME: ENGLISH COLOR: Azzuro Blue Breccia Broken Pieces Dorato/D'oro Gold Fiore Flower Giallo Yellow Negro/Nero Black Perla/Perlato Pearl Rosa Pink Rosso Red Verde Green Bianco White Example: Negro Marquina- Black Marble from Marquina, Spain. Bianco Carrara- White Marble from Carrara, Italy.
